Location & geography
Swampscott is situated along the North Shore of Massachusetts, approximately 2 miles northeast of Lynn and about 11 miles north of Boston. The total land area of Swampscott is about 3.02 square miles, complemented by a water area of 0.57 square miles. Transportation
Swampscott is easily accessible via Route 1A, which runs along the coast and connects to nearby highways for broader travel. The closest major airport is Logan International Airport in Boston, situated about 13 miles to the south. Public transportation options include the Massachusetts Bay Transportation Authority (MBTA), which offers commuter rail service to Boston.
History
Swampscott was settled in the early 17th century and officially incorporated in 1852. Originally a fishing and farming community, it evolved into a popular summer resort destination in the late 19th century, attracting visitors to its beaches.
